sql >> Database teknologi >  >> RDS >> Mysql

python mysql.connector DictCursor?

Ifølge denne artikel er den tilgængelig ved at sende 'dictionary=True' til markørkonstruktøren:http://dev.mysql.com/doc/connector-python/en/connector-python-api-mysqlcursordict.html

så jeg prøvede:

cnx = mysql.connector.connect(database='bananas')
cursor = cnx.cursor(dictionary=True)

og fik:TypeError:cursor() fik et uventet søgeordsargument 'ordbog'

og jeg prøvede:

cnx = mysql.connector.connect(database='bananas')
cursor = cnx.cursor(named_tuple=True)

og fik:TypeError:cursor() fik et uventet søgeordsargument 'named_tuple'

og jeg prøvede også denne:cursor = MySQLCursorDict(cnx)

men til ingen nytte. Jeg er tydeligvis på den forkerte version her, og jeg formoder, at vi bare skal være tålmodige som dokumentet på http://downloads.mysql.com/docs/connector-python-relnotes-en.a4.pdf antyder, at disse nye funktioner er i alfa-fase på tidspunktet for skrivning.



  1. Hvordan redigerer man en lagret procedure i MySQL?

  2. Et kig på Oracle Group-by Bug

  3. Hvordan kan jeg få procentdelen af ​​de samlede rækker med mysql for en gruppe?

  4. Sådan får du sidste række pr. gruppe i PostgreSQL